Luke is an excellent writer: this is one of his points of beautiful conclusion and transition, carrying forward his historical narrative. It offers and description and demonstration of the life of the new covenant community under the influence of the Holy Spirit.
First we see great unity, great generosity, great power, and great grace, digging down to the foundations of the life of the church of the risen Jesus.
Then we have a further general positive pattern of this gospel-driven charity and a specific positive example in Barnabas.
While we must face the fact that Satan hates such a heavenly atmosphere, and will spoil it if he can by persecution and corruption, yet still it provides us with a sweet snapshot of the lives of people bound together in Christ by the Holy Spirit.
